Descripción general

Product class

M-P, Homogeneous Catalysts, Phosphorus Ligands - Achiral


Reaction type

Cross Coupling Reactions with Arenes, Carbonylation, Kumada Coupling Reaction, Mizoroki Heck Coupling Reaction, Sonogashira-Hagihara Coupling Reaction, Stille Reaction, Reduction


Chemical properties

Chemical formula

C36H28Cl2OP2Pd

Empirical formula

[Pd(DPEphos)Cl2]

Molecular weight

715.88

Metal

Pd

Theoretical metal content

15

Physical state

powder

Metal purity

99.95

Propiedades químicas y físicas
SensibilidadMoisture sensitive
Punto de fusión (°C)243-250°C
Peso molecular715.900 g/mol
